Output 39b728b23a6b49545bfbce8a6fc6c25f237a98062d20a6dcd8e5a396ef00a303:2

value
170000
script pubkey
OP_0 OP_PUSHBYTES_20 bd1384d01c850f9ae7e05738cd9f4e55635eca9f
address
bc1qh5fcf5qus58e4elq2uuvm86w2434aj5lz70ttv
transaction
39b728b23a6b49545bfbce8a6fc6c25f237a98062d20a6dcd8e5a396ef00a303
confirmations
159066
spent
true